What is a 10 Bar Air Compressor?
A 10 bar air compressor is a kind of air compressor that can deliver compressed air at an optimal pressure of 10 bar, which is roughly 145 psi (pounds per square inch). This level of pressure is ideal for numerous jobs, ranging from light-duty applications to demanding industrial procedures.
Fundamental Operation of a 10 Bar Air Compressor
The basic mechanism behind air compressors involves drawing in ambient air, compressing it within a chamber, and after that expelling the high-pressure air. The main components that play a crucial function in a 10 bar air compressor include:

Check service warranty terms and maker support for comfort.Frequently asked question About 10 Bar Air CompressorsQ1: How much compressed air is required for pneumatic tools?
A1: The needed amount of compressed air is figured out by the tool's requirements, usually measured in CFM. Tools like nail guns might need 2-4 CFM, while impact wrenches may require 4-7 CFM.
Q2: Can a 10 bar air compressor be used for spraying paint?
A2: Yes, a 10 bar air compressor appropriates for spray painting jobs. However, it's important to make sure the compressor can provide adequate CFM to maintain constant pressure for optimal spray results.
